  1. Totally old school, even gold is taken like a normal item.
  2. Too bad the camera is locked. Never liked it because you can't use the minimap for navigation and more annoyingly because ranged units might shoot at you without being seen on the screen especially from the north and south.
  3. Stronger units seem to be giving usual low level items.
  4. Since it's always night, you can bypass most creatures.
  5. Well, I guess the farmer scene should start after the ogres are all dead.
  6. Quests have non-DISBTN icons (green squares).
  7. Not sure what gnolls to find for the farmer's weapon if all have been killed before getting the quest.
  8. Items like Cloak of Fire can kill neutral passive units. Not that it matters?
  9. Most if not all ramps are glitched.
  10. Not sure how is this supposed to work well: fighting those mages near a fountain of health. From my experience, the obvious advantage is on the heroes.
  11. A problem is that you could potentially die in the desert, a place that requires save-load which is a pain in multiplayer.
  12. No more experience on neutrals after level 5.
  13. The southern part of the Swamp of Sighs looks ugly because you can see the dust cliffs and terrain right after the grass ends abruptly. That part should not be playable.
  14. I guess you have to be careful where you kill the flying sheep, else no branch?
It's nice map, but that's kind of it. For its time it might have been quite good.
